Kinds Of Nissan Keys
Before diving into the copying process, it's crucial to understand about the various kinds of keys that may be used in Nissan vehicles. The key type can impact how you tackle copying it.
Key TypeDescriptionTraditional KeyA standard metal key without any electronic components.Transponder KeyA key with a chip embedded within it that communicates with the car's ignition system.Smart Key/ Proximity KeyA keyless entry system that enables the chauffeur to begin the car without placing a key.Summary of Key TypesStandard Key: Common in older Nissan designs, these are simple metal keys that can be easily cut at any locksmith or hardware store.Transponder Key: Typically used in models from the late 1990s and onwards, these keys consist of an RFID chip that need to be set to the automobile's ignition system. Copying these keys needs special devices.Smart Key/ Proximity Key: Present in newer designs, these systems enable keyless entry and ignition. Copying these keys is more complex and might need dealer intervention.How to Copy Your Nissan Key

1. Can I copy my Nissan key myself?
Just traditional keys can typically be copied without expert assistance. For transponder and smart keys, you will require a locksmith professional or car dealership.
2. How much does it cost to copy a Nissan key?
Costs can vary:Traditional keys: ₤ 2-₤ 5Transponder keys: ₤ 50-₤ 100 (including programs)Smart Keys: ₤ 150-₤ 500 depending upon the design and shows.
3. What if I don't have my original key?
If you've lost your only key, your best alternative is to contact a Nissan dealer or a locksmith who specializes in automotive keys. You'll need your VIN and proof of ownership.
4. Can I copy my key at any locksmith?
Not all locksmiths have the capability to deal with transponder or smart keys, so it is best to verify their competence in advance.
5. The length of time does it take to copy a key?
Traditional keys can be copied in a few minutes, while transponder and smart keys can take anywhere from 15 minutes to several hours, especially if shows is included.
